What is partial veto?
Partial veto is when a government official rejects only specific parts of a legislation, rather than the entire bill.
Who is required to file partial veto?
The government official with the veto power, such as the President or Governor, is required to file a partial veto.
How to fill out partial veto?
The government official must specify the parts of the legislation they wish to veto and provide a written explanation for their decision.
What is the purpose of partial veto?
The purpose of a partial veto is to allow the government official to remove or modify specific provisions of a bill while still allowing the rest of the legislation to become law.
What information must be reported on partial veto?
The partial veto must clearly state which parts of the legislation are being vetoed and provide a rationale for the veto.
